### 2.2 Hardware Requirements
| Component | Specification | Supported Alternatives |
|——————–|————————-|——————————-|
| Processor | Intel i5/i7 Gen 10+ | AMD Ryzen 5 equivalent |
| RAM | 16GB DDR4 | 32GB recommended |
| Storage | 500GB NVMe SSD | 1TB PCIe 4.0 optimal |
| OS | Windows 10/11 Pro | Linux-based solutions |
| Connectivity | USB 3.2 Gen 2 | Thunderbolt 4 compatibility |
_Source: OEM Requirements Guide [5][7][10]_

### 3.1 Xentry Openshell vs PassThru
Feature | Openshell | PassThru
————————-|——————————-|—————————–
Connection Method | SD Connect C4/C5/C6 | J2534-compliant tools
Diagnostic Coverage | 1990-2025 models | Euro 5/6+ vehicles
Coding Capabilities | Full SCN programming | Limited module access
Hardware Cost | $5,879+ | $299-$1,200
_Data compiled from multiple dealer sources [1][5][9][13]_
